Folding Leaves, the latest record from Message to Bears, takes the idea of something rustic and organic and tenderly crafts it into musical origami: something complex and detailed, yet gracefully simple.
Jerome Alexander, the multi-instrumentalist behind MTB, combines layers of rustic strings, crisp acoustic guitar and a warm, almost wordless vocal melody – a sound which builds throughout each song and across the whole album. The resolution of each crescendo – after the communal, folksy accumulation of voices, strings and other instruments – is either triumphant, or left to crumble away on a breeze of bird song and crackling ambience.
The effect is an album that is unfolding in two ways: both as an old letter or map, unfurling to display detail and emotion, or disappearing, as an origami swan pulled at two ends loses its creases, becoming as formless and unassuming as it began.'
credits:
Released 18 January 2012 by Dead Pilot Records and Nature Bliss (Asia) including bonus track.
Composed and produced by Jerome Alexander at Message To Bears studio in Oxford. Viola and violin performed by Laura Ashby. Mastered by Keith Kenniff. Artwork by Jake Blanchard.
